Tony Stewart's Sprint Car Racing is an oval-racing game centered on sprint cars and dirt-track competition. It targets casual and dedicated dirt-racing players with career events, car customization, local multiplayer, and online races.

World of Outlaws: Sprint Cars is a dirt-track racing game based on the American World of Outlaws sprint car series. It targets...

Pros

  • Focused specifically on sprint car and dirt-oval racing
  • Includes a structured career and championship progression
  • Offers more authentic World of Outlaws context than general racing games

Cons

  • Discontinued and difficult to obtain through official stores
  • Visuals and physics are substantially dated compared with current racers
  • Limited modern online multiplayer support

World of Outlaws: Dirt Racing is a modern dirt-track racing game featuring sprint cars, late models, and other oval-racing classes. It is...

Pros

  • Closest modern replacement with licensed World of Outlaws content
  • Includes sprint cars alongside multiple dirt-racing classes
  • More current graphics, handling, and multiplayer than the original

Cons

  • Still has a narrower racing focus than iRacing or Assetto Corsa
  • Console availability varies by platform and region
  • Career presentation is less polished than mainstream circuit racers
